12 and 15 Passenger Van Regulations


In order to stay compliant with policy changes made by the Department of Administration (DOA), the following 12-15 passenger van use guidelines are in effect. Please also refer to the updated State of Wisconsin Guidelines for 12-15 Passenger Vans.

  • No 12 or 15 passenger van travel beyond the State of Wisconsin or Minnesota is allowed through UWRF fleet. 
  • Drivers must be at least 25 years old, no transporting of students under the age of 18, and no towing of trailers is allowed with state vehicles.
  • A training course is required for all 12 and/or 15 passenger travel.  This applies to both UWRF fleet vehicles that are 12 and/or 15 passenger in nature and include similar vehicles rented from Enterprise.
  • Training will be arranged through Facilities Management on a regular basis. Sessions will be provided as needed based on demand.  Individuals are encouraged to attend the training closest to their intended travel date. Class consists of on-line training plus 30 minutes behind the wheel as well as riding time.  Plan for two hours total time for the training.  Cost for training is $50 per person and is the responsibility of the Department.  
  • NOTE:  Training is good for three years.
